Formula or Method

CO₂ = Σ(fuel × factor); gas: 5.3 kg/therm; oil: 10.15 kg/gal; propane: 5.74 kg/gal

Example

Example inputs: Monthly Electricity: 900 kWh; Grid Factor: 0.386 kg/kWh; Monthly Natural Gas: 50 therms; Annual Heating Oil: 0 gallons; Annual Propane: 0 gallons

Example result: Using the default inputs, estimated annual home energy emissions are 7,349 kg CO₂, or 7.35 metric tons.
